Medicines to control … WebJun 28, 2024 · Vestibular neuritis is also known as vestibular neuronitis, labyrinthitis, neurolabyrinthitis, and acute peripheral vestibulopathy [ 1 ]. A group of leading international experts has proposed the term "acute unilateral vestibulopathy" (AUVP) as the preferred name for this condition [ 2 ]. It is a self-limited disorder, and most patients recover ...

WebJan 1, 2024 · Abstract. Otalgia (ear pain) is a common presentation in the primary care setting with many diverse causes. Pain that originates from the ear is called primary otalgia, and the most common causes are otitis media and otitis externa. Examination of the ear usually reveals abnormal findings in patients with primary otalgia.
